I keep both panels (the menubar and taskbar) at the top of the screen. I recently tried the "autohide" option, and now...well, both my panels have disappeared. All I have left at the top is a white strip. (I attached a screenshot)

How can I roll back the panels to their default setting? My desktop isn't usable like this >.<

Haah. That's what I get for googling the wrong term.



1. rm -r ~/.gconf/apps/panel or just move the folder elsewhere if you want to back it up.
2. Log out of Gnome, then back in.
3. There is no step 3.
